iOS 14.2.1 update is rolling out for iPhone 12 Series

iOS 14.2.1 is the third update of this week including the iOS 14.3 Beta 2. And about a day ago Apple released the revised iOS 14.2 update which is available only through iTunes and Finder for iPhone 12 series. And the third update which is iOS 14.2.1 is also the update for only iPhone 12 series. The rollout begins at the standard time, unlike the last two beta updates. The update fixes bugs specific to the iPhone 12 Mini, iPhone 12, iPhone 12 Pro, and iPhone 12 Pro Max. And it is rolling out as an OTA update, so you will get the update to your phone unlike the revised iOS 14.2. iOS 14.2.1 Update

iOS 14.2.1 update for iPhone 12 is available with the build version 18B121. And the update size varies as per the different iPhone 12 models. Apple has also released the macOS Big Sur 11.0.1 update with build number 20B50 and you can directly install it on your Mac. iOS 14.2.1 Update – Changelog

iOS 14.2.1 addresses the following issues for your iPhone:

  • Some MMS messages may not be received
  • Made for iPhone hearing devices could have sound quality issues when listening to audio from iPhone
  • Lock Screen could become unresponsive on iPhone 12 mini

Download & Install iOS 14.2.1

The update is limited to only iPhone 12 series. So if you have iPhone 12, iPhone 12 Mini, iPhone 12 Pro, or iPhone 12 Pro Max then you can update to the latest iOS 14.2.1. The update will be available on the device as OTA. So if you are not on any beta then you can update your iPhone 12 to the latest iOS 14.2.1.

In case if you didn’t get an update notification on your iPhone. Then you can go to Settings > General > Software Update to check for the latest update. And once you see the update you can click on ‘Download & Install’ to get the update.

You can also install the updates manually with iTunes or Finder. You can use IPSW files if you are planning to install it through your computer.
